Bayesiansk Negativ Binomial Regression

Bayesiansk Negativ Binomial Regression modellerer ikke-negative heltals-tællingsudfald, der udviser overdispersion – hvor variansen overstiger middelværdien – ved at placere en negativ binomial likelihood på dataene og specificere prior-fordelinger over regressionskoefficienterne og dispersionsparameteren. Posterior inferens udføres typisk via Markov chain Monte Carlo (MCMC) eller variationelle metoder, hvilket giver fulde posterior-fordelinger snarere end punktestimater.
